Semantic Colour
Neutral is the default and colour is an exception that carries exactly one meaning — at most three semantic hues plus greys, and never colour on its own.

Spacing and Proximity
Whitespace is the primary grouping mechanism. Things that belong together sit close; things that do not sit apart — and uniform padding everywhere is a decision not to have grouped anything.

Visual Hierarchy
Size, weight, colour and position are a currency with a fixed supply. Spend them in proportion to importance, and accept that emphasising everything emphasises nothing.
